The Minnesota Twins defeated the Kansas City Royals 3-2 at Target Field on July 28, 2026. Royce Lewis hit a walk-off, two-run triple in the bottom of the ninth to secure the victory. Despite hitting into five double plays and trailing 2-1 in the sixth inning, the Twins rallied back. Starting pitcher Taj Bradley recorded 10 strikeouts over six innings, and the bullpen contributed three shutout innings.
